Description
In this engaging narrative, the world of Lord Peter Wimsey and Harriet Vane unfolds with wit and sophistication. The story showcases the clever interplay between the two protagonists as they navigate the complexities of murder, love, and societal expectations in early 20th-century England. Lord Peter, an aristocratic detective with a penchant for solving intricate mysteries, finds himself drawn to Harriet, a talented mystery novelist who is more than capable of holding her own against his charms.
As their paths intertwine, the tension between them brews, revealing deeper themes of trust and intellect. Set against a backdrop of genteel society, each character is vividly portrayed, capturing both their strengths and vulnerabilities. Sayers masterfully blends elements of mystery and romance, creating an atmosphere charged with intrigue.
Throughout their journey, the duo confronts their personal demons while fighting against the constraints of their respective social standings. Their evolving relationship raises questions about identity, purpose, and the nature of love, ensuring that readers are thoroughly captivated until the very last page.
